Understanding Threaded Inserts and Drill Size Requirements
Threaded inserts provide durable, reusable threads in materials like wood, plastic, and metal. Different types of inserts—such as heat-set inserts, press-fit inserts, and screw-in inserts—have specific drill size requirements. Choosing the correct drill size ensures a snug fit without splitting the material or creating loose threads.
Always refer to the manufacturer’s specifications before installation. These specifications usually provide recommended pilot hole diameters. Ignoring these guidelines can weaken the connection and reduce overall performance.

Measuring Drill Size for Screw-In Threaded Inserts
For screw-in threaded inserts, the drill size should match the insert’s outer thread diameter. A hole that is too small increases installation torque and may damage the insert or workpiece, while a hole that is too large results in poor grip.
To determine the correct drill size, measure the insert’s outer thread diameter using a caliper or ruler, then consult the manufacturer’s installation chart for the recommended pilot hole. This ensures flush installation and maximum holding strength.

Drill Size Considerations for Heat-Set Threaded Inserts
Heat-set threaded inserts, commonly used in plastics, require precise drill sizing to prevent cracking or material deformation. For heat-set threaded inserts, the pilot hole should be slightly smaller than the insert’s outer diameter, allowing the heated insert to displace surrounding material properly.
When drilling, make sure the drill bit is sharp and perpendicular to the workpiece. Controlling drilling speed and feed helps avoid chipping or warping, resulting in a clean installation.

Best Practices for Installing Threaded Inserts
Regardless of the insert type, following best practices ensures a successful installation:
- Use a straight, sharp drill bit to maintain accurate hole size.
- Check the recommended insertion depth to avoid over- or under-insertion.
- For larger inserts, consider a step drill or countersink to facilitate smoother installation.
These measures prevent stripped threads or misaligned inserts, enhancing the durability of the assembly.
Why Drill Size Matters for Threaded Insert Performance
Selecting the right drill size directly affects threaded insert performance. A properly sized hole ensures full thread engagement, maximizes holding power, and minimizes material damage. Correct installation reduces maintenance and prevents component failures, making it essential for woodworking and metalworking applications.
